Tips for Getting More Guests Involved
Getting everyone to participate is the key to a full, rich collection of birthday memories. Here are a few simple tricks:
- Print the QR code and place it on tables, the photo booth, or near the cake station.
- Announce it at the start — a quick mention from the host or MC goes a long way.
- Make it fun with a prompt list, like "snap a photo with the birthday person" or "capture your favorite moment."
- Offer a small prize for the most creative shot to encourage participation.
